During an asphalt shingle roof installation, homeowners can generally expect a series of organized steps managed by local service providers. The process usually begins with a thorough inspection, followed by removal of the old roofing material if necessary. Once the underlying deck is prepared and inspected for damage, new layers of underlayment are installed to provide additional protection. The shingles are then carefully laid out and secured, with attention paid to proper alignment and sealing. Once the installation is complete, the contractor will typically perform a final inspection to ensure everything meets quality standards. This comprehensive approach ensures that the new roof is properly installed and ready to provide reliable protection for years to come.

During an asphalt shingle roof installation, property owners in the area can expect a process that involves several key stages. Typically, local contractors will start by preparing the existing roof surface, which may include removing old shingles and inspecting the underlying structure. This ensures a solid foundation for the new roof. Throughout the project, homeowners might notice activity on their property such as the presence of workers, the use of tools, and the movement of materials. It’s common for installers to work in sections, gradually covering the roof with new shingles, which helps minimize disruption and keeps the work organized.

Understanding what to expect during an asphalt shingle roof installation can help property owners plan accordingly. Local service providers usually aim to keep the process efficient, but some noise and debris are normal during the work. They may also take steps to protect landscaping and outdoor items. Once the installation is complete, a thorough inspection often follows to ensure everything is properly secured and aligned. What should I expect during an asphalt shingle roof installation? During the installation, local contractors typically prepare the work area, remove old roofing materials if necessary, and install new shingles systematically to ensure proper coverage and durability.

Will there be any disruptions to my daily routine during the installation? It’s common for there to be some noise, debris, and limited access to certain parts of the roof while local service providers work, but they usually coordinate to minimize inconvenience.

How do contractors ensure the roof is installed correctly? Local pros follow standard installation practices, including proper shingle placement, secure fastening, and adequate ventilation, to promote a long-lasting roof and protect the underlying structure.

What kind of preparation is needed before the installation begins? Homeowners are typically advised to clear the area around the house, protect landscaping, and ensure access to the roof to facilitate a smooth installation process by local service providers.

What should I do after the asphalt shingle roof installation is complete? It’s recommended to inspect the work, address any concerns with the contractors, and ensure proper cleanup, so the new roof can provide reliable protection for years to come.
